Handyman prices in Musaffah

Researched estimates for Musaffah (AED), adjusted for city size from national ranges. Updated 2026.
Job size Low Typical High
Single task visit One mounting, repair, or fitting job including call-out AED 90 AED 170 AED 280
Multi-task visit 3-5 small jobs batched into one visit AED 230 AED 370 AED 550
Half-day works Larger list across an apartment or villa AED 370 AED 550 AED 830
Move-out fix list Repairs and touch-ups before handover inspection AED 280 AED 550 AED 1,100

How to hire a handyman pro in United Arab Emirates

  1. Use a company with a valid trade licence in your emirate — the UAE handyman market is dominated by licensed maintenance companies rather than independents
  2. Compare per-hour rates (AED 100-200) against annual maintenance contracts if you own a villa — AMCs bundle handyman visits with AC and plumbing
  3. In Dubai rentals, check your tenancy contract's minor-maintenance clause (often tenant pays below ~AED 500 per item)
  4. For apartment buildings, confirm the company can obtain the community/building work permit
  5. Agree scope and price on the app or in writing before the visit — established platforms (ServiceMarket, Justlife) publish fixed prices
  6. Confirm materials are itemized separately

Handyman companies in the UAE must hold an emirate trade licence for the relevant activities, and electrical work beyond minor fittings must be done by licensed electrical contractors under municipality/DEWA rules. Building and community managements typically require work permits for in-unit jobs.

Frequently asked questions

Can a handyman do plumbing and electrical work?

Small like-for-like fixes — replacing a tap washer, a toilet flush mechanism, a light fitting on an existing point — are commonly done by handymen where local law allows. New circuits, consumer-unit work, gas appliances, and anything behind walls generally require a licensed electrician or plumber, and in several countries even socket replacement is restricted. How much should small common jobs cost?

As a rule of thumb in most markets: hanging a shelf or a few pictures is under an hour; mounting a TV is 1-1.5 hours; re-sealing a bath is 1-2 hours; adjusting or rehanging a door is about an hour. Multiply by the local hourly rate on this page and add materials. If a quote for one such task equals a half-day rate, get a second quote.

Is my handyman insured if something goes wrong?

Only if they carry public liability insurance — ask for proof before work that could cause damage (drilling near pipes, working at height, plumbing fixes). A burst pipe behind a wall or a TV that falls off its mount can cost far more than the job itself. Reputable handymen expect the question.

Do handymen supply materials or should I buy them?

Either works, but agree upfront. Handymen typically add 10-20% to materials they buy — fair payment for their time sourcing them. For anything specific (a particular light fitting, tap, or shelf bracket), buy it yourself first and let the visit be pure labor. Always ask for receipts if they buy on your behalf.

What does a handyman cost in Dubai and the UAE?

Licensed companies charge AED 100-200 per hour with a one-hour minimum, or fixed per-task prices (e.g. TV mounting AED 100-250, curtain rod installation AED 80-150 per rod). Villa annual maintenance contracts covering handyman, AC, and plumbing callouts run AED 1,500-4,000 per year.

Who pays for small repairs in a UAE rental?

Standard Dubai tenancy contracts make the landlord responsible for major maintenance and the tenant for minor repairs, often defined by a per-item threshold around AED 500. Read your contract's maintenance clause and report issues through the landlord's nominated company first — using your own contractor without approval can forfeit reimbursement.
